directions

  • Preheat oven to 350°.
  • Grease 13 x 9 inch baking pan (I like to use the wrapper from the butter to do this).
  • Beat butter and sugars in a large mixing bowl until creamy.
  • Add eggs and beat well.
  • Sift together flour, baking soda, salt and nutmeg; gradually add to butter mixture, blending well.
  • Stir in cinnamon chips, white chocolate chips and nuts.
  • Spread into prepared pan. The batter will be very thick.
  • Bake 30 to 35 minutes or until top is golden brown and center is set.
  • Cool completely in pan on wire rack.
  • Cut into bars.
